Gay Arabs Begin To Organize In Israel



A rare gathering of openly gay Arab activists will be held in Israel shortly, drawing the ire of religious conservatives. Headlined “Home and Exile,” the March 28 meeting is meant to spark discussion of homosexuality among Israel’s one million Arab citizens. The conference is being organized by Aswat, an Arab lesbian group based in Haifa. Around 100 to 150 people are expected to show up. With homosexuality a taboo topic in much of the Arab world, the meeting is important simply because it is taking place.

Time For The NOW Man - The Second Passion Of Photographer Johan van Breukelen



Johan van Breukelen is known in gay Holland as a photographer and artist, and his photos are now on display in Mr. B, the leather and rubber shop on the Warmoesstraat. Van Breukelen’s erotic photos appear to be more painting than photo. He calls his photos “painting with light” and he considers himself more of a visual artist than a photographer. In 1995 he also was joint founder of the Men’s Work Foundation (Stichting Mannenwerk), which gives (gay) men the chance to meet each other in a different, more intense, setting than is usual in the pubs and clubs. A conversation about the unfamiliar side of this respected (men’s) photographer.

Michael Jackson Upset By Gay Porn Connection



Michael Jackson tried to fire the man he hired to produce a benefit recording for victims of the 2001 terrorist attacks after learning the associate once directed gay porn movies, according to the entertainer’s former lawyer. Zia Modabber testified early July that he broke the news to Jackson about F. Marc Schaffel’s background, showing him a video of Schaffel at an adult film shoot. “I think he didn’t want to believe it was real or true,” said Modabber. “He appeared angry, upset.”

Homostudies - Bestiality and Homosexuality in Sweden



The major accomplishment of Jens Rydström in his study on Swedish bestiality and homosexuality is the confirmation of Michel Foucault’s theory of the change from a legal system of forbidden acts to a medical system of marginalized identities in the first volume of Histoire de la Sexualité (1976). Swedish courts routinely condemned “unnatural fornication” (as male and female homosexuality and bestiality were called since the law reform of 1864) as a criminal offense till the early twentieth century.

Life Behind Bars For Gay Massage Parlour Slayings



In March, the two men responsible for the brutal slayings at Sizzlers, a gay massage parlour in Capetown, on January 19 last year, where each sentenced to nine life terms in prison. They were found guilty on nine charges of murder and one of attempted murder. Former waiter Adam Woest, 27, and taxi driver Trevor Theys, 43, both admitted that they were involved in the gruesome deed, but they blamed each other for the killings.

Poet Thom Gunn Dies At 74



On April 25 the poet Thom Gunn died at his home in San Francisco, his adopted hometown. Thomson William Gunn was born on August 29 1929 in Gravesend, Kent, England and was educated at Trinity College, Cambridge. He wrote his first poem for a student magazine, and its success prompted him to adopt that medium to express himself.

Rare New Infection Disease



Twenty-five men from the party scene in Amsterdam and Rotterdam have caught the sexually transmitted infection disease LGV (Lymphogranuloma Venereum). According to medical experts we are dealing with a rare situation, in Holland we never had a break out of this rare infection before. The decision has been made to act up together and to fight this disease. In all cases, it has occurred among men with homosexual sex contacts, mainly in the party scene.

HIV Vaccin Trial

The Health Department Amsterdam is one of the participants in a trial for a HIV vaccin. Testing starts in March and will take eighteen months. The study will inquire into the safety of the vaccin and try to determine the most effective dose. The researchers will also look into the immunoreactions the vaccin might cause. The possible vaccin, HIVA.MVA, is designed as a preventive treatment. It's intended to protect against an infection with HIV.
